By Logan Weingartner
CANANDAIGUA, N.Y. - The Finger Lakes Community College baseball team dropped both games of a doubleheader to SUNY Niagara, which sits at 37-0 to date and is ranked #2 overall in the latest NJCAA DIII rankings.
The Lakers struggled to get going offensively in game 1, falling 13-1. Joey Sanna (Hilton, N.Y./Hilton) connected on a double in the bottom of the 4th, while Trey Buchholz (Shinglehouse, P.A./Bolivar Richburg) struck an RBI single three innings later for the team's sole run of the contest. Ian Goodness (Palmyra, N.Y./Palmyra-Macedon) earned the start on the mound and distributed 5 strikeouts, while Andrew Wood (Big Flats, N.Y./Horseheads), Ty Joy (Warsaw, N.Y./Warsaw) and Alex Dungey (Webster, N.Y./Webster Thomas) each appeared for an inning apiece, with Dungey accounting for 3 strikeouts.
The Lakers went down 5-0 to start game 2, but cut the deficit to 3 in the 5th inning when Nate Hill (Webster, N.Y./Webster Thomas) delivered an RBI single, followed up with a score by Christian Morrison (Macedon, N.Y./Palmyra-Macedon) on a wild pitch. However, the Thunderwolves would put the game away two innings later with 2 runs of their own in the final inning to finalize a 7-2 victory. Caleb Wilson (Rochester, N.Y./Aquinas) took the mound for 5 innings and dealt out 4 strikeouts, while Tino Tiermini (Irondequoit, N.Y./West Irondequoit) came in for the final 2 innings and put up a solid performance with 2 strikeouts.
